Federal Agents Tase Anti-ICE Protester in Newark Amidst Ongoing Clashes; Arrests Made

By | May 27, 2026

Federal agents employed a taser on a demonstrator identified as an anti-ICE leftist in Newark, New Jersey, as ongoing clashes and confrontations escalated at the scene. The incident, which reportedly involved the use of pepper spray and tear gas, culminated in the arrest and detention of at least one individual. The events unfolded as a protest against the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) agency reached a critical point, with tensions running high between demonstrators and law enforcement.
